What is it?

Starting a dropshipping store is a creative business idea where you sell products online without holding any inventory. You partner with suppliers who ship products directly to your customers, making it a low-risk way to earn money for your adventure trips. This method works well for tech-savvy teens who enjoy marketing and customer service.

Why does it work?

Dropshipping leverages e-commerce and digital marketing to reach a wide audience with minimal upfront cost. Because you don’t buy stock upfront, you reduce financial risk while still offering products that appeal to your target market. The convenience and low barrier to entry motivate consistent sales and growth.

What you'll need

  • A computer or smartphone with internet access
  • An e-commerce platform account (e.g., Shopify, WooCommerce)
  • Supplier accounts (e.g., AliExpress, Oberlo)
  • A PayPal or bank account to receive payments
  • Basic graphic design tools (Canva or similar)
  • Social media accounts for marketing (Instagram, TikTok, Facebook)

Step-by-step plan

1
Choose a niche that interests you and has a demand, such as outdoor gear, fitness accessories, or travel gadgets. Research trending products on sites like AliExpress or Amazon.
2
Set up your online store using an e-commerce platform like Shopify. Pick a clean, user-friendly theme and add essential pages such as About, Contact, and Shipping information.
3
Connect your store with dropshipping suppliers using apps like Oberlo or Spocket. Import products with appealing descriptions and high-quality images into your store.
4
Set competitive prices by calculating your costs plus a profit margin (usually 20-40%). Remember to factor in shipping fees and potential taxes.
5
Create social media profiles to showcase your products. Post regularly with engaging content such as product demos, customer reviews, and behind-the-scenes videos.
6
Launch targeted advertising campaigns using Instagram or TikTok ads with a small budget to test which products perform best.
7
Provide excellent customer service by responding promptly to inquiries and solving problems professionally to build trust and repeat customers.
8
Track your sales and expenses carefully using spreadsheets or accounting apps. Adjust your marketing and product range based on what sells well.

Top tips

✅ Focus on a narrow niche to stand out and make marketing easier.
✅ Always order sample products yourself to check quality before selling.
✅ Use free tools like Canva to create professional-looking images and videos.
✅ Be patient—dropshipping takes time to build momentum and trust.

Common mistakes to avoid

⚠️ Choosing too broad or saturated a niche, leading to poor sales.
⚠️ Ignoring customer service and failing to respond quickly to messages.
⚠️ Setting prices too low or too high without factoring in all costs.
